ASTRO, known as the "icons of freshness," has consistently charmed fans worldwide with their vibrant and energetic music and performances. Debuting in 2016, they have quickly risen to fame with their dynamic sound and engaging performances.


The "GATEWAY" album marks a pivotal entry in ASTRO’s discography, showcasing their maturity and versatility. The album features a mix of genres, emphasizing ASTRO's evolution in the K-pop industry.
